- Carefully fit the gear shafts of primary shaft -1- and secondary shaft -2- at the
same time.
2
- Fit 2nd gear sprocket -1- and adjusting washer -2- to the primary shaft.
- Fit the desmodromic valve to the semi-crankcase making sure that it is aligned
with the marks (arrows) made during the dismantling.
- Place forks -1- into the grooves of the gears and in turn into the grooves of the
desmodromic valve.
- Then slide shafts -2- (short) and -3- (long) through the forks to their housings
3
on the semi-crankcase.

JOINING THE SEMI-CRANKCASES
- Turn the bedplate so that the left-hand semi-crankcase is facing upwards and
remove the nut that fixes the engine to the bedplate.
- Check that the contact surfaces of the left and right-hand semi-crankcases are
completely clean.
- Fit the centring bushings to the left-hand semi-crankcase.
- Fit the new gasket.
- Fit the right-hand semi-crankcase and tap with a plastic mallet until the two
surfaces are joined.
